What Is Chiropractic Care?

Chiropractic care focuses on restoring proper movement and function of the spine and nervous system. When the spine is misaligned, it can cause pain, tightness, headaches, limited mobility, and even impact how your body functions overall. Through precise spinal adjustments, chiropractors help reduce that interference—often leading to immediate relief and long-term improvements.

Common Signs You May Need an Adjustment

  • Recurring neck or back pain
  • Stiffness or limited range of motion
  • Frequent headaches
  • Poor posture or sitting long hours
  • Feeling out of alignment or “off”
  • Trouble sleeping or staying comfortable

Even if you’re not in pain, regular chiropractic visits can help support a healthier nervous system, improve posture, and prevent issues before they become more serious.
